With expertise in the field of Health Sciences education, assessment, and the implementation of training programs, Dr. Serigne Magueye Gueye is currently the Director of the Franco-Senegalese Campus (CFS), which brings together the best Senegalese and French institutions to offer new high-quality programs that address the development priorities of Senegal.

Dr. Serigne Magueye Gueye has also served as the President of the commission responsible for reforming the programs at the Faculty of Medicine of Cheikh Anta Diop University. He played an active role in the development of projects for the establishment of the Universities of Thiès, Bambey, and Ziguinchor.

He was part of the expert committee for the creation of the Faculty of Health Sciences at the University of St. Louis and coordinated the committee for the establishment of the Faculty of Health Sciences at Ziguinchor, Amadou Mahtar MBOW University, and Touba University.

Dr. Serigne Magueye Gueye has taught Health Sciences at various Senegalese universities such as Cheikh Anta Diop University in Dakar, Gaston Berger University in St. Louis, and Thiès University.

He was a member of the Scientific and Pedagogical Council of the Doctoral School of Life Sciences and Environment (SEV) and Coordinator of the program reform commission at the Faculty of Medicine, Pharmacy, and Dentistry.

He also represented the FMPO (Faculty of Medicine, Pharmacy, and Dentistry) at the University Assembly. As the coordinator of the program reform commission, he worked on modernizing and improving the programs of the Faculty of Medicine, Pharmacy, and Dentistry.

Furthermore, as a member of the Scientific and Pedagogical Council of the Doctoral School of Life Sciences and Environment, he has contributed to higher education in Africa.

Titles and academic positions

1988-1993
Head of Urology Clinic, Cheikh Anta Diop University, Dakar
1990-1992
Head of the Clinic - associate Professor of Urology, University of Bordeaux II
1993
Master - Assistant of Urology
1996
Aggregation in surgery, specializing in urology, 8th CAMES competition, Abidjan (Section Major)
2000
Full Professor of Urological Surgery, CTS CAMES
Since 2000
Head of the Urology Department at Grand Yoff General Hospital
